Prior Approval Scheme definition

Prior Approval Scheme means a scheme under which the Responsible Commissioner gives Prior Approval for treatments and services prior to referral or following initial assessment that may form part of the Services required by the Service Users following referral;
Prior Approval Scheme means a scheme under which the Commissioner gives Prior Approval for treatments and services that may form part of the secondary care Services required by the Service User following referral;
Prior Approval Scheme means any scheme for the giving of Prior Approval by the Responsible Commissioner;

Examples of Prior Approval Scheme in a sentence

  • A Prior Approval Scheme will typically set out a commissioner policy for access to a certain service or treatment – a high-cost drug, for instance, or a treatment of perceived low clinical value.

  • Where patients have a legal right of choice of provider, any Prior Approval Scheme which simply restricts that choice is void and cannot be used to restrict payment for activity carried out by the provider.

  • SC29.3-4 deal with referral protocols and clinical thresholds for treatment and make clear that such documents may be included within service specifications or other aspects of the contract which are agreed between commissioner and provider – but that, in other circumstances, they may instead be notified by the commissioner to the provider as a Prior Approval Scheme (described more fully below).

  • The commissioner must respond to a request for approval for treatment within this Prior Approval Scheme Response Time Standard or will be deemed to have given approval under SC29.25.

  • Failure by the Commissioner to respond to a request for Prior Approval within the appropriate time period specified in such Prior Approval Scheme shall be deemed to be an approval for the purposes of that Prior Approval Scheme.

  • The Commissioner shall respond in accordance with its Prior Approval Scheme to any Provider request for Prior Approval that complies with the terms of such Prior Approval Scheme.

  • The Provider shall manage patients in accordance with the terms of any relevant Prior Approval Scheme.

  • If the Commissioner requires any amendment to be made to a Prior Approval Scheme, then Module D, Schedule 3 the Commissioner shall consult with the Provider on the proposed amendment, and when the amendment has been agreed by the Commissioner and the Provider, the Commissioner will give the Provider one month’s notice in writing of the date on which the amendment to the Prior Approval Scheme is to be implemented by the Provider.

  • The Commissioner shall, where the 18 Weeks Referral-to-Treatment Standard is at risk for any activity that is the subject of a Prior Approval Scheme, require the Provider to specify a revised pathway to mitigate any risk of failure to meet the 18 Weeks Referral-to-Treatment Standard.

  • In the context of NCA, the key points to note are that• a CCG cannot require a provider operating on an NCA basis to implement that CCG’s Prior Approval Schemes; and • a Prior Approval Scheme must not be used to restrict a patient’s legal right of choice of provider.
